about summary refs log tree commit diff
path: root/src/libstd/sys
AgeCommit message (Expand)AuthorLines
2018-09-02Auto merge of #53725 - tbu-:pr_getrandom_syscalls, r=alexcrichtonbors-40/+26
2018-09-02Fix an endless loop when `getrandom` is not availableTobias Bucher-0/+1
2018-09-01Auto merge of #53884 - kennytm:rollup, r=kennytmbors-19/+19
2018-09-01Rollup merge of #53076 - QuietMisdreavus:cfg-rustdoc, r=GuillaumeGomezkennytm-19/+19
2018-08-31use cfg(rustdoc) instead of cfg(dox) in std and friendsQuietMisdreavus-19/+19
2018-08-31Make `Condvar::new` and `RWLock::new` min const fn for cloudabiOliver Schneider-6/+10
2018-08-30Rollup merge of #53786 - frewsxcv:frewsxcv-bad-style, r=ManishearthPietro Albini-6/+6
2018-08-30Rollup merge of #53756 - dmerejkowsky:fix-comment, r=KodrAusPietro Albini-1/+1
2018-08-30Rollup merge of #53743 - oconnor663:target_env, r=kennytmPietro Albini-27/+27
2018-08-29Don't leak the file descriptor in `rand`Tobias Bucher-44/+11
2018-08-29Replace usages of 'bad_style' with 'nonstandard_style'.Corey Farwell-6/+6
2018-08-28Fix typo in commentDimitri Merejkowsky-1/+1
2018-08-27fix a typo: taget_env -> target_envJack O'Connor-27/+27
2018-08-27Fix anon param + make it allow-by-defMark Mansi-1/+8
2018-08-26Reduce number of syscalls in `rand`Tobias Bucher-39/+57
2018-08-24Rollup merge of #53311 - RalfJung:windows-mutex, r=retep998kennytm-0/+2
2018-08-21Rollup merge of #53329 - frewsxcv:frewsxcv-ptr-add-sub, r=RalfJungkennytm-1/+1
2018-08-20Replace usages of ptr::offset with ptr::{add,sub}.Corey Farwell-1/+1
2018-08-19Fix typos found by codespell.Matthias Krüger-2/+2
2018-08-18Auto merge of #53436 - cuviper:trace_fn-stop, r=alexcrichtonbors-24/+30
2018-08-16std: stop backtracing when the frames are fullJosh Stone-24/+30
2018-08-17Rollup merge of #53395 - varkor:__Nonexhaustive-to-non_exhaustive, r=shepmasterkennytm-9/+9
2018-08-15Start adding an `aarch64-pc-windows-msvc` targetAlex Crichton-4/+94
2018-08-15Make cloudapi enums #[non_exhaustive]varkor-9/+9
2018-08-14Rollup merge of #53208 - BurntPizza:protect-the-environment, r=alexcrichtonkennytm-5/+1
2018-08-14fixed wordingRalf Jung-1/+1
2018-08-13Window Mutex: make sure we properly initialize the SRWLockRalf Jung-0/+2
2018-08-11Add links to std::char::REPLACEMENT_CHARACTER from docs.Corey Farwell-1/+2
2018-08-09Don't panic on std::env::vars() when env in null.BurntPizza-5/+1
2018-08-09Auto merge of #53108 - RalfJung:mutex, r=alexcrichtonbors-2/+8
2018-08-08missed oneRalf Jung-2/+2
2018-08-08avoid using the word 'initialized' to talk about that non-reentrant-capable s...Ralf Jung-2/+2
2018-08-08Use repr(align(x)) for redox in6_addrLinus Färnstrand-1/+1
2018-08-06actually, reentrant uninitialized mutex acquisition is outright UBRalf Jung-6/+4
2018-08-06clarify partially initialized Mutex issuesRalf Jung-2/+10
2018-08-06Remove references to `StaticMutex` which got removed a while agoRalf Jung-3/+0
2018-08-02Auto merge of #52847 - upsuper:thread-stack-reserve, r=alexcrichtonbors-1/+4
2018-07-31Fix coding style.Colin Finck-1/+4
2018-07-30Add targets for HermitCore (https://hermitcore.org) to the Rust compiler and ...Colin Finck-14/+33
2018-07-30Auto merge of #52805 - ljedrz:format_str_literal, r=petrochenkovbors-1/+1
2018-07-30Don't commit thread stack on WindowsXidorn Quan-1/+4
2018-07-29Auto merge of #52738 - ljedrz:push_to_extend, r=eddybbors-11/+8
2018-07-29Replace push loops with collect() and extend() where possibleljedrz-11/+8
2018-07-29Auto merge of #52767 - ljedrz:avoid_format, r=petrochenkovbors-1/+1
2018-07-28Don't format!() string literalsljedrz-1/+1
2018-07-27Auto merge of #52336 - ishitatsuyuki:dyn-rollup, r=Mark-Simulacrumbors-10/+10
2018-07-27Prefer to_string() to format!()ljedrz-1/+1
2018-07-25Merge remote-tracking branches 'ljedrz/dyn_libcore', 'ljedrz/dyn_libstd' and ...Tatsuyuki Ishi-8/+8
2018-07-25Add missing dynTatsuyuki Ishi-2/+2
2018-07-24Rollup merge of #52656 - jD91mZM2:stablize-uds, r=alexcrichtonMark Rousskov-1/+41